Magisk Module to change SIM number? - Magisk

Is there a module or is one possible that can change the number stored on the SIM? I started a new monthly plan and transferred my old number over, but the new SIM card carries the wrong (new) number. I was able to change it before using an Xposed mod to do it (can't remember name now) but this isn't usable yet on Nougat afaik.

Salty Wagyu said:
Is there a module or is one possible that can change the number stored on the SIM? I started a new monthly plan and transferred my old number over, but the new SIM card carries the wrong (new) number. I was able to change it before using an Xposed mod to do it (can't remember name now) but this isn't usable yet on Nougat afaik.
Click to expand...
Click to collapse
That doesn't actually change your number, you'll need to contact your service provider to make sure your number ported over correctly.

HermitDash said:
That doesn't actually change your number, you'll need to contact your service provider to make sure your number ported over correctly.
Click to expand...
Click to collapse
It has ported over correctly, just the new SIM card is hardcoded with the new number that About Phone > Status > SIM status reads from. Trying a new app that first requires registration usually pulls that number and autofills it in your signup window doesn't it? Hence the reason wanting to change it.

Yeah... No Magisk modules for that. I'd request a new SIM from your provider, with the correct number.

Ah ok, thanks. Will just wait it out for Xposed to come

its possible if mod located on file or folder but if inside the code of framework or apps then not possible.
Sent from my Redmi Note 2 using Tapatalk

Insert SIM to iPhone and change sim number. Or "old gen. mobile phone" like Nokia 3310 (not smartphone).

You can also get a smartcard reader for your pc and write it to SIM.

xposed sim editor 1.3.0 will do what you need. Note that if you use dual sim just insert the sim to edit to sim1 and leave sim2 empty, change and restart and change again and restart again.

This works:
[APP][XPOSED] SIM Number Setter
SIM Number Setter SIM Number Setter is a small Xposed module that invokes normally unused Android System code to set the "subscriber number" on the device's SIM card. This is the number displayed in the system settings, and used in apps such as...
forum.xda-developers.com

Related

[TIPP] Remove S Finder and Quick Connect from Menu

hi guys,
many of you will find the space taken by the "quick connect" and "s finder" buttons in the pulldown menu wasted.
since i already read requests on how to remove them, here is the simple way:
caution: you need to be rooted
grab a file explorer like "root explorer" and navigate to /system
create a backup of your build.prop-file
now edit the build.prop and change the line "ro.product.name=trltexx" to "ro.product.name=trltevzw". save the file and reboot your phone.
your phone will now think it is the verizon variant and hence show a different 4g-logo, but apart from that your quick menu is clean and you don't have that menu space wasted anymore.
as always, i am not responsible for whatever harm you do to your phone.
btw: you could also change the value to "trlteatt", but that will change further stuff (like boot animation) so rather go for the verizon variant.
There's also a positive side to it: When using the phone with one hand you can reach the notifications much easier.
Thanks. I changed mine from tre3gxx to tre3gvzw on my 910H and that annoying row is gone.
Oops: It didn't connect to network. So back to tre3gxx.
Is this the exynos version?
In this case you need to either write the whole string to what I have or check what other values are legit for exynos phones.
v1rtu4l said:
Is this the exynos version?
In this case you need to either write the whole string to what I have or check what other values are legit for exynos phones.
Click to expand...
Click to collapse
Yes it is exynos version. trltevzw didn't work too. That bar was gone but it didn't connect to network. Btw there is here is no LTE in my region.
there is no reason that this only works for the snapdragon version.
if you have a exynos version you need to find the product code of a exynos note 4 variant and provider who disables it by default and choose that.
what you basically do by changing it to treLTEVZW is tell the software that this is the verizon variant and the software will disable those menu features because that was a deal struck between samsung and verizon. so if you find a provider that has those features disabled on an exynos version you just need the product name and use it.
i tried this on my exynos version and upon reboot, i lost my IMEI, it was showed as null/null..luckily i had EFS bacup, tried restoring that but then my phone went crazy, restarting every 20 seconds, restored the original build.prop aswell, reflashing the FW from odin fixed it! Phew
Are you sure you did nothing else? The build.prop has nothing to do with your imei.
What you describe is usually result of bad modding or flashing.
The OP actually works. Make sure the permissions are rw-r-r.
N910G Note 4 Snapdragon running on latest BOE4 lollipop.
I will continue monitoring my phone if any features or functions were affected.
Thank you for the author. Good work.
Edit:
Unfortunately the feature to increase/decrease the brightness in "auto" mode disappeared. I need this function, therefore I had to revert back.
tried this on the note 4 rooted N910G running stock 5.0.1, the sfinder and connect still visible. am i missing something, does this work for lollipop?
EDIT : it worked changing to att at the end....but now i see the stupid carrier logo on the left end of notification
Does not work on 910C in Europe (Austria). Lost Network Connectivity (2G/3G/4G, everything exccept Wifi.
Any Other Solutions?
Just accomplished this
I just accomplished this task on my T-Mobile note 4 doing exactly as described above. I changed the "tmo" to "vzw" and restarted after making a back up copy of the file and placing it in the storage on the phone. I have lollipop so couldn't use xposed framework yet...
Model number
SM-N910T
Android version
5.0.1
Baseband version
N910TUVU1COD6
***NOTE*** the only issue with using the Verizon version is the 4GLTE symbol on the status bar changed and is always visible. But no issue to me. See the pictures I attached

Dual Sim choice on texting

Good evening. I can't find any rom with decent RAM management that allows me to choose between sim cards and make one the default to a certain contact, like shown below. Also, I've already been on CM 12.1 and had to go stock, second SIM was required.
Note that the option "Remember ote that the option "Remember SIM for number" is important...
(see pic attached)
Thanks in advance
h*tp://i.imgur*com/AGy80wt.png
(had to change link due to new user rules, sorry in advance)

Blu r1 dual ringtones

I have a Blu r1 with dual sims both Ultrame, I cannot set dual ringtones on marshmallow 6.0 I have read this is a system-wide issue with marshmallow on many dual sim phones seems sony took the hardest hit. I am wondering, since I cannot find a third party app. that works, for my own curiosity, when using dual sims does the phone look for two different networks to identify the two numbers orrr does it only recognize sim one, sim two as two different calling circuits altogether? I am used to it by now but am wondering is there a fix for this or anybody who has found a thrid party app to install dual ringtones? This is a basic work phone, and I need the dual sims, but having two different ringtones would help a lot.
red423 said:
I have a Blu r1 with dual sims both Ultrame, I cannot set dual ringtones on marshmallow 6.0 I have read this is a system-wide issue with marshmallow on many dual sim phones seems sony took the hardest hit. I am wondering, since I cannot find a third party app. that works, for my own curiosity, when using dual sims does the phone look for two different networks to identify the two numbers orrr does it only recognize sim one, sim two as two different calling circuits altogether? I am used to it by now but am wondering is there a fix for this or anybody who has found a thrid party app to install dual ringtones? This is a basic work phone, and I need the dual sims, but having two different ringtones would help a lot.
Click to expand...
Click to collapse
I had a different Blu phone "life one x" and it is duel sims. The duel ringtone setup was a custom "profile" on the sound & notification settings page. But when that profile was there you could not change the ring tones. It would only allow it to change to the ones stored in a /system folder (don't remember which one) . Any way that profile is not nlt on this phone and I was not able to create it either, so. Maybe an alternative option might be to set all your contact in your phone book to a group and set that group to a custom ringtone, that way you know if the caller is someone you know vs a potential new customers.
thanks for the input
Thanks for replying,
I see your idea and it would work except, in my business I receive calls in on both numbers one is in Miami the other is on the other coast of fla. so depending on where I am at the time I still would love to get dual ringtones, One for Miami the other for the west coast number, my groups have both numbers to contact me,in case of emergency, so it would be best for me to have a dual set up for new calls in. I am still looking for an app that will work on MM I am sure with all the complaining one will show up sooner or later............
mrmazak said:
I had a different Blu phone "life one x" and it is duel sims. The duel ringtone setup was a custom "profile" on the sound & notification settings page. But when that profile was there you could not change the ring tones. It would only allow it to change to the ones stored in a /system folder (don't remember which one) . Any way that profile is not nlt on this phone and I was not able to create it either, so. Maybe an alternative option might be to set all your contact in your phone book to a group and set that group to a custom ringtone, that way you know if the caller is someone you know vs a potential new customers.
Click to expand...
Click to collapse
red423 said:
Thanks for replying,
I see your idea and it would work except, in my business I receive calls in on both numbers one is in Miami the other is on the other coast of fla. so depending on where I am at the time I still would love to get dual ringtones, One for Miami the other for the west coast number, my groups have both numbers to contact me,in case of emergency, so it would be best for me to have a dual set up for new calls in. I am still looking for an app that will work on MM I am sure with all the complaining one will show up sooner or later............
Click to expand...
Click to collapse
found this app.
DuelSim Ringtone
I dont have two sim cards so I could not verify if it works.
It lets me set different tones for the different slots but without two cards, could not verify if its working
thanks for input still not working............
As far as I can tell, I use two phone numbers under the same carrier, I believe most of these dual ringtone apps are set to catch two different carriers not singular. I was hoping for an app that would see slot one slot two and relate to that. shame really. but oh well I will be dropping the one line soon so not a big deal. Thanks for the replys
mrmazak said:
found this app.
DuelSim Ringtone
I dont have two sim cards so I could not verify if it works.
It lets me set different tones for the different slots but without two cards, could not verify if its working
Click to expand...
Click to collapse

Note 8 Dual Sim Personal Profile question

Hi all.
I have a bit of an odd query.
On my Note 8, in Contacts, my profile at the top of the page...the default phone number keeps going to SIM 2's number.
I change it to default to SIM 1's number all the time and within a few minutes goes back to SIM 2.
I edit the profile and even delete the number, but sure enough, within a few minutes, SIM 2 number is back as the default profile number.
Why would this be please?
Anyone, please?
Also...can the profile be viewed by anyone else...or is it strictly an on-phone thing?
Mine is not real dual sim, but I have already changed to dual sim.
The number is not linked to sim 1 or 2, just a number in the profile,
Mine is working well, didn't change back automatically, but I didn't share the profile.
---------- Post added at 15:39 ---------- Previous post was at 15:36 ----------
ap10046 said:
Anyone, please?
Also...can the profile be viewed by anyone else...or is it strictly an on-phone thing?
Click to expand...
Click to collapse
If you are sharing the profile,
When I call your number (whatever I got from website or somewhere) and I don'k know your name, Samsung will show your name automatically which you are sharing.
I tested this with my friend, but not 100% sure.
Hi.
Thank you for your response.
So the SIM 2 number will actually show up on my profile (which I am not sharing)?

How To Guide [ROOT] Enable 5g, VOLTE and call screening in unsupported countries.

Hello Guys
I managed to enable 5G, VOLTE and call screening in Bahrain (Unsupported Country).
Follow the steps below to get these services.
1. Get rooted and install Magisk [Guide Link].
2. Download VOLTE module in magisk to have VOLTE after reboot [Guide Link].
You should have VOLTE now.
3. Download Network Signal Guru [App Link].
Give it Root access
Click The Three dots and choose Forcing Control
Choose [1]SIM 1 (it might be sim 2 for you, depending on which sim u using for mobile data)
Choose [3] NR MODE SETTINGS
Choose [4]SA+NSA
Reboot
You should have 5g now.
4. To get call screening, download and install Market Enabler [APP LINK]. and give it root access.
5. Enable VPN and set it to USA. I used VPN Master with the 7 days trial (Make sure to cancel subscription in Google Play so you dont get charged after the 7 days)
6. Open Market Enabler and select USA.
7. Make sure you have the latest version of the phone app, and join beta if possible.
8. Now while both VPN and Market Enabler is set to USA, clear cache from phone app
9. Open phone app and go settings and you should see Spam and Call Screen. if it didnt show .. just keep clear cache and try again till it show (I had to try multiple times till it worked).
Note: u wont have to have VPN on after this (One time step only), however whenever u reboot ur device or it turns off. Once the phone is ON make sure to do step 6 to not lose call screening.
thanks' a lot
i will try it at night
could you check your dm please? thank you
Does your network drop out, and shows no service for a while before resetting the value and returns to LTE?
These may be the most prominent features missing on Wildcard.
There are more however that need research:
1) LTE Carrier Aggregation is limited to only 2 carriers
2) LTE 256 qam upload is missing
3) ENDC NR CA doesnt seem to work (maybe?)
I've tried to crack the 1st point without any success - I presume the /vendor/firmware/carrierconfigs/confseqs "lte_ca_0.common" confseq file (the names are in the headers of the files) includes mnc specific combinations inside of it, so editing of it in some form is required.
You can do
Code:
for file in ./*;echo $file;strings -n5 $file;end
in the confseqs (or manifests) directory to see all the names in the headers.
These files luckily do not seem to be signed or encrypted, however they are binary blobs and hence unreadable. I see references to CLZ4 in the header of some of these files, however trying to unlz these files doesn't work, likewise binwalk and other tools detect nothing. Possibly compiled protobufs? Would need to trace through how these files get handled and by what service on the phone.
The second point is doable, /vendor/firmware/carrierconfigs/cfg.db is an sqlite database where carriers get their confseq files assigned. The quickest way to play around with replacing the Wildcard profile for the "unsupported countries" is to edit the regional_fallback table and country_code 0 for another carrier_id from the confnames table. The file can be replaced on the filesystem via creating a simple Magisk module zip. Some of these profiles do have 256 qam upload enabled in them, I used dk_telia (656) and it works fine. This also enabled DSS for 5G, something for which the 5G nvitem toggle in NSG didnt account for.
Third one seems to be active, atleast it reports ENDC NRCA combinations to the network via ue capability messages, however it does not seem to go active when network conditions are met. Hence I assume it is a case similar to the LTE CA one where NRCA would have to be enabled.
if there is no 5G in your country, then maybe there is no infrastructure for it, tuning your phone I dont think will fix that.
THX ALOT
Thanks a lot. This is helpful.
Could this work to enable Call Recording? If so, does anyone know the list of countries where call recording and screening are both supported?
Thank you for sharing
Will try it today, and get back to you.
Pixel 7 pro, UAE-Etisalat
anasmhds said:
Thank you for sharing
Will try it today, and get back to you.
Pixel 7 pro, UAE-Etisalat
Click to expand...
Click to collapse
5G is working fine for 1st time in Pixel 7 pro, UAE-Etisalat
Little heating the phone comparing with 4G/LTE
Did not try call screening
first i will thank every one help me
i got 5g
tbh I don't care about 5G at all but one feature I'm interested in to work is wifi calling, any info about it?
kakashi_ax said:
tbh I don't care about 5G at all but one feature I'm interested in to work is wifi calling, any info about it?
Click to expand...
Click to collapse
yap
salamdiab said:
yap View attachment 5759999
Click to expand...
Click to collapse
How?
kakashi_ax said:
How?
Click to expand...
Click to collapse
I just follow this guide and on the sim tap i just make the WIFI calling ..sorry if i send a lot of pic
I can't get it to work on Jio(India). It might be a carrier side toggle too.
Theres a way to do it without root?
alawii_shark said:
Hello Guys
I managed to enable 5G, VOLTE and call screening in Bahrain (Unsupported Country).
Follow the steps below to get these services.
1. Get rooted and install Magisk [Guide Link].
2. Download VOLTE module in magisk to have VOLTE after reboot [Guide Link].
You should have VOLTE now.
3. Download Network Signal Guru [App Link].
Give it Root access
Click The Three dots and choose Forcing Control
Choose [1]SIM 1 (it might be sim 2 for you, depending on which sim u using for mobile data)
Choose [3] NR MODE SETTINGS
Choose [4]SA+NSA
Reboot
You should have 5g now.
4. To get call screening, download and install Market Enabler [APP LINK]. and give it root access.
5. Enable VPN and set it to USA. I used VPN Master with the 7 days trial (Make sure to cancel subscription in Google Play so you dont get charged after the 7 days)
6. Open Market Enabler and select USA.
7. Make sure you have the latest version of the phone app, and join beta if possible.
8. Now while both VPN and Market Enabler is set to USA, clear cache from phone app
9. Open phone app and go settings and you should see Spam and Call Screen. if it didnt show .. just keep clear cache and try again till it show (I had to try multiple times till it worked).
Note: u wont have to have VPN on after this (One time step only), however whenever u reboot ur device or it turns off. Once the phone is ON make sure to do step 6 to not lose call screening.
Click to expand...
Click to collapse
I tried these steps yesterday and it did not work for me. Anyone else with a similar issue and does anyone know why it isn't working?

Categories

Resources